The Department of Roads is planning to repair and install traffic lights at various locations in Kathmandu. The department has plans to spend around 2 million for the project, which will include installing the traffic lights at more than 20 locations in the valley.
Backstory:
- The Department had repaired the traffic lights at New Baneshwor and Maharajgunj earlier. The repair was successful and the lights have been operational.
- The Department had also tried to install “Intelligent Traffic Control System”, however, the bid didn’t pan out.
